Asgeir from Iceland:

Darcia and Stefan are wonderful hosts. Prior to our stay we got a detailed e-mail on how to get to the house from the airport (drawn on to a aerial photo) and info on bus routes close by. At arrival they are friendly and offer us some coffee and tea. The bedroom is a good size, the beds comfortable and plenty of closet/drawers for clothes. The breakfast is a very good way to start the day – new bread, good cheese, jams, eggs (made to your liking), yoghurt, cereal, juice and coffee/tea. The place is on the edge of town but you really don’t mind because there are two buses that stop 3min from doorstep and go approx every 5-10min. A very cosy neighbourhood, safe and a lot of playgrounds. Superb hosts, overall probably one of the best options when staying in Umeå!
